A meteor explosion off the coast of Massachusetts sent a shockwave through the state on Saturday, causing a loud boom that was heard by residents across the region.

The blast, which occurred at 2:11 p.m. Eastern Time, was equivalent to about 300 tons of TNT, according to NASA. Dozens of people reported hearing the explosion, with some describing a sudden bang that rattled windows and startled pets.

Meteor Explosion

The meteor is believed to have entered the atmosphere over the South Shore near Boston, with satellite data showing a signature consistent with a meteor at the time of the boom. Preliminary reports submitted to the American Meteor Society indicate that dozens of people across the Northeast saw the fireball, helping scientists piece together the meteor’s path.

Most meteors burn up harmlessly in the atmosphere, but larger objects can occasionally survive long enough to create brilliant fireballs and booming shock waves. Meteors enter Earth’s atmosphere at incredible speeds, often traveling between 25,000 and 160,000 miles per hour, creating powerful shock waves that can be heard dozens of miles from the meteor’s actual path.

Impact and Implications

The U.S. Geological Survey explained that sonic boom events, like the one that occurred on Saturday, happen along a linear path in the atmosphere, unlike earthquakes which occur at discrete locations. Astronomy educator Shauna Edson noted that if the meteor landed off the coast of Massachusetts, it would be unlikely that any pieces of it would be found, as the vast majority of meteorites land in the ocean.
